About Bobby Thomson

Bobby Thomson was a Scottish-born American professional baseball player best known for hitting a game-winning home run known as the 'Shot Heard 'Round the World' to win the National League pennant for the New York Giants in 1951. He played as an outfielder during his Major League Baseball career, predominantly for the New York Giants and the Milwaukee Braves. Thomson was a three-time All-Star and played a crucial role in the Giants' success during the early 1950s.
